피드로 돌아가기
Three no-signup dev tools we shipped this week
Dev.toDev.to
Frontend

LLM 기반 JSON/HAR 분석을 통한 TypeScript SDK 자동 생성 도구 구현

Three no-signup dev tools we shipped this week

SolvoHQ2026년 5월 15일1beginner

Context

API 응답 및 환경 변수 설정 시 발생하는 수동 인터페이스 작성 과정의 비효율성 발생. 런타임 타입 불일치로 인한 Type Safety 결여 및 반복적인 보일러플레이트 코드 작성의 병목 지점 식별.

Technical Solution

  • JSON 페이로드를 기반으로 TypeScript Interface 및 Zod Schema를 자동 생성하는 jsontosdk 설계
  • LLM을 활용한 시맨틱 네이밍 부여로 단순 타입 변환을 넘어선 가독성 높은 코드 생성 구조 채택
  • .env 파일의 비정형 데이터를 검증 가능한 typed env.ts 및 .env.example 파일로 변환하는 dotenv2types 로직 구현
  • HAR 네트워크 트레이스 데이터를 분석하여 리소스 그룹화 및 인증 감지가 포함된 fetch SDK를 생성하는 har2sdk 아키텍처 설계
  • 별도의 Backend 서버 없이 Browser 상에서 모든 변환 과정을 처리하여 Zero-signup 및 낮은 Latency 구현

- API 응답값 기반의 Zod Schema 도입을 통한 런타임 타입 검증 체계 구축 - HAR 파일을 활용한 네트워크 레이어의 인터페이스 자동 추출 및 Mock SDK 생성 검토 - .env 설정 파일의 정적 타입 정의를 통한 process.env 접근 시의 Type Safety 확보

원문 읽기